Ingredients
- 1 medium banana (120 g)
- 1/2 cup mango (75 g)
- 1 cup coconut milk (240 g)
- 1 tsp lime juice (5 g)
- 1 tsp ginger (5 g)
- 1 scoop chia seed (30 g)
- 1/2 cup ice (60 g)
How to make Thai Coconut Smoothie
- Prep. Peel the banana and chop the mango into chunks. Grate a small piece of fresh ginger.
- Load. Add all ingredients to your portable blender, starting with the liquids.
- Blend. Blend until smooth and creamy, adding more ice if needed to reach your desired consistency. If the smoothie is too thick, add a splash more coconut milk.
- Serve. Pour into a glass and enjoy immediately. Garnish with a sprinkle of chia seeds or a wedge of lime, if desired.
Pro tips
For a thicker smoothie, use frozen mango or banana chunks. If you prefer a sweeter flavor, add a touch of honey or maple syrup. For a richer taste, use full-fat coconut milk. If you like a spicy kick, add a small pinch of cayenne pepper.
This recipe is easy to double or triple for batch blending. Store any leftover smoothie in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ours. Shake well before serving, as some separation may occur. A quick re-blend can restore the original texture.
Variations
- Pineapple Twist. Add 1/2 cup of pineapple chunks for an extra tropical flavor.
- Green Boost. Include a handful of spinach for added nutrients without significantly altering the flavor.
- Spicy Thai. Add a small pinch of red pepper flakes for a mild heat.
- Creamier Texture. Add a tablespoon of coconut cream for an even richer, more decadent smoothie.

FAQ
Can I use other types of milk?
While coconut milk is essential for the authentic Thai flavor, you can substitute with almond milk or oat milk for a lighter option. Keep in mind that this will alter the overall taste and texture.
Can I make this smoothie ahead of time?
Yes, you can blend this smoothie ahead of time and store it in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ours. Be sure to shake well before serving, as some separation may occur. A quick re-blend will restore the original texture.
I don't have fresh ginger. Can I use ground ginger?
Yes, you can substitute 1/4 teaspoon of ground ginger for the fresh ginger. However, fresh ginger provides a more vibrant and complex flavor.
